Show Brady - director of special education Mr. Con Brady, Director of Special Education for the Alpine School District, has announced his retirement effective this spring. Brady has worked in education for a period of 28 years, starting at the Orem High School in 1957 as a teacher and counselor. In 1963 he took a position with Ayer High School in California where he remained for one year. He returned to Orem High School in 1964 as the Assistant Principal. In 1967 he was appointed Principal at American Fork Junior High School. He was named as Principal for the American Fork High School in 1969 where he served until 1977. At that time, he assumed the leadership role at the Dan Peterson School for the multiply handicapped. han-dicapped. He assumed his present position in 1983. Brady received both the B.S. and M.S. degrees from BYU. He accomplished ac-complished further graduate . studies at the University of Utah and Utah State University. ...He has served as President of the Alpine Education Association and as Program Committee Chairman for the Utah Association of Secondary Principals.
